CGL are proud to be part of the corporate sponsorship of the National F1 Bloodhound Class Champions of 2011, as they head to Malaysia for the World Championships.
F1 in Schools offers children, from ages 9 to 19, an exciting yet challenging opportunity to be part of an F1 educational experience that raises international awareness of Formula One whilst creating an environment for young people to develop an informed view about careers in engineering, Formula One, science, marketing and technology. And CGL are glad to be there to help raise the profile.
Team Solstice, as the F1 Team are now known, held a demonstration and fund raising evening this month to thank local companies and the press who have supported the team over recent months, CGL being one of them! The evening gave Team Solstice a chance to demonstrate their talents and share the excitement of designing, building and racing a scale F1 car on a 20m track. Everyone attending was given the opportunity to try their hand at propelling the team’s model cars down the track and testing their response times in a competition for the fastest trigger finger.
